Terms Comparison: What Decides Real Value
Headline bonuses are meaningless without understanding the terms attached. Our testing revealed significant variation in wagering requirements, with multipliers ranging from a generous 20x to a punishing 65x. A £50 bonus at 35x requires £1,750 in turnover; the same bonus at 65x requires £3,250. That difference of £1,500 is entirely at the operator’s discretion, and it fundamentally changes the value proposition.

Wagering requirements are commercial terms set by each operator, and they typically fall between 20x and 65x. Some sites apply a single multiplier across all games, while others differentiate between slots and table games. Slots usually contribute 100% toward wagering, whereas blackjack and roulette often contribute far less — sometimes as little as 5%. This distinction can turn a supposedly generous bonus into an impossible task, so always read the contribution table before playing.
Payout speed is another area where the small print matters. The times above reflect e-wallet withdrawals, which are almost always faster than bank transfers. Some operators also impose a maximum withdrawal amount per transaction, which can stretch a large win across several days. Check this limit before you play, not after you win.
Understanding the Terms Glossary
The gambling industry is full of jargon designed to obscure rather than illuminate. The glossary below translates the most common terms into plain English, along with a practical note on what each one means for your bankroll.
| Term | Plain-English Meaning | Practical Note |
|---|---|---|
| Wagering requirement | How many times you must bet the bonus before withdrawing | Lower is better; 20x is generous, 65x is punitive |
| Game contribution | What percentage of each bet counts toward wagering | Slots usually count 100%; table games far less |
| Max bet limit | The largest single bet allowed while using a bonus | Exceeding it can void the bonus and any winnings |
| Payout limit | Maximum amount you can withdraw in a single transaction | Large wins may be split across several days |
| Verification | Documents required to confirm your identity | Some operators allow minimal checks for fast payouts |
